Unverified Commit aafa2b2c authored by Emily's avatar Emily Committed by GitHub
Browse files

Merge pull request #241179 from SuperSandro2000/matrix-sliding-sync

matrix-sliding-sync: init at 0.99.3
parents cc085f09 fe01e756
Loading
Loading
Loading
Loading
+37 −0
Original line number Diff line number Diff line
{ lib
, buildGoModule
, fetchFromGitHub
}:

buildGoModule rec {
  pname = "matrix-sliding-sync";
  version = "0.99.3";

  src = fetchFromGitHub {
    owner = "matrix-org";
    repo = "sliding-sync";
    rev = "v${version}";
    hash = "sha256-lmmOq0gkvrIXQmy3rbTga0cC85t0LWjDOqrH1NWUpdA=";
  };

  vendorHash = "sha256-447P2TbBUEHmHubHiiZCrFVCj2/tmEuYFzLo27UyCk4=";

  subPackages = [ "cmd/syncv3" ];

  ldflags = [
    "-s"
    "-w"
    "-X main.GitCommit=${src.rev}"
  ];

  # requires a running matrix-synapse
  doCheck = false;

  meta = with lib; {
    description = "A sliding sync implementation of MSC3575 for matrix";
    homepage = "https://github.com/matrix-org/sliding-sync";
    license = with licenses; [ asl20 ];
    maintainers = with maintainers; [ SuperSandro2000 emilylange ];
    mainProgram = "syncv3";
  };
}
+2 −0
Original line number Diff line number Diff line
@@ -9546,6 +9546,8 @@ with pkgs;
  matrix-conduit = callPackage ../servers/matrix-conduit { };
  matrix-sliding-sync = callPackage ../servers/matrix-synapse/sliding-sync { };
  matrix-synapse = callPackage ../servers/matrix-synapse { };
  matrix-synapse-plugins = recurseIntoAttrs matrix-synapse.plugins;